Chase Belton has been named to the D3football.com Team of the Week, presented by Scoutware, for his efforts in the Little Giants' 49-0 victory Saturday over Kenyon.
Belton accounted for five of Wabash's seven touchdowns against the Lords, throwing for three and running for two scores. He completed 11 of his 13 pass attempts for 203 yards, including a 47-yard TD pass to
Wes Chamblee, a 61-yard scoring strike to
Jonathan Horn, and a seven-yard pass for a touchdown to
Jeff Bell. Belton became the first Little Giant player to amass more than 100 rushing yards in a game this season, carrying the ball five times for 110 yards. He scored on carries of 47 and 13 yards.
Belton, a product of Northmont High School in Dayton, Ohio, has completed 51 of 85 pass attempts this season for 849 yards and 11 touchdowns with only three interceptions. He is 176-of-284 in passing for 2,577 yards and 28 touchdowns to this point in his career. He threw for a total of 13 touchdowns last season while splitting time at quarterback. Belton is averaging 3.1 yards per carry this season, rushing for a total of 140 yards in 45 attempts.
The Wabash football team is 4-0 and is ranked 12th in the latest D3football.com poll and 13th by the American Football Coaches Association.
